John Le Fondré Jr


John Alexander Nicholas Le Fondré (born 1966) is a Jersey politician, and accountant. He entered the States of Jersey in the 2005 elections, as deputy for the Parish of St Lawrence. He served as Assistant Finance Minister until 20 July 2007, when he assumed the position of Assistant Chief Minister.

John Alexander Le Fondré is the son of the late Deputy John Le Fondré (after whom the Jersey Airport departures hall is named).

He was educated at Victoria College, and went to Kingston Polytechnic to read Accounting and Finance. This included four months at the business school in Montpellier, France, where he became fluent in French. He graduated with an Upper Second Class Honours and went to work for Ernst and Young, both in Jersey and Luxembourg.

He is a Chartered Accountant, and a member of the Institute of Chartered Accountants in England & Wales (UK) and a member of the Information Systems Audit and Control Association (USA).

He has taken a keen interest in parish affairs, acting as treasurer to the St Lawrence Battle of Flowers Association from 2001 – 2005, and also treasurer to the St Lawrence Parish Magazine – Les Laurentins from 2003 to the present.

He was a Committee Member of the St Lawrence Millennium Committee, and in that capacity also acted as Project Manager for the St Lawrence Millennium Footpath Project (1997 – 2004), also writing and summarising much of the written information on display about the path on the information boards and individual signs, as well as working on the completion of the path itself.
